Abstract
We present results of quasi-phase matching (QPM) interactions in one-dimensional multilayered media consisting of layers with different χ(2) nonlinearities that interchanged by linear dispersive layers. We exploit the idea of manipulating overall group delay mismatches between the various fields in each layer by appropriate choosing of the dispersive parameters and consider both multiple optical QPM interactions and preparation of pure photon states in application to quantum gates.
